Forensic science is a field that involves the application of scientific methods and techniques to investigate crimes and legal cases. Forensic scientists play a crucial role in identifying, analyzing, and interpreting physical evidence, providing valuable insights into criminal investigations. In this article, we will discuss ten essential skills that every forensic scientist should possess to succeed in this field.

1. Attention to Detail

Forensic investigations often involve analyzing complex pieces of evidence, such as bloodstain patterns, fingerprints, or DNA samples. A forensic scientist must have a keen eye for detail and be able to detect subtle differences or anomalies that may be relevant to the case. A single overlooked detail can have significant consequences, so attention to detail is critical in forensic science.

2. Analytical Thinking

Forensic scientists must be able to think logically and critically to evaluate evidence and draw conclusions. They must be able to analyze information from multiple sources, identify patterns, and make connections between different pieces of evidence. Analytical thinking helps forensic scientists generate hypotheses and develop testable theories based on the evidence.

3. Technological Proficiency

Forensic science involves the use of sophisticated technologies and equipment, such as microscopes, spectrometers, or chromatographs. A forensic scientist must be proficient in using these tools and understand their capabilities and limitations. As technology evolves, forensic scientists must stay up-to-date with new developments and techniques to ensure they can provide the best possible analysis.

4. Communication Skills

Forensic scientists must be able to communicate complex scientific concepts and findings to individuals with varying levels of scientific knowledge, including law enforcement officials, lawyers, judges, and juries. Effective communication skills are essential in writing reports, presenting evidence in court, and collaborating with other professionals involved in a case.

5. Ethical Conduct

Forensic scientists must maintain high standards of ethical conduct in their work. They must ensure that the evidence they analyze is collected and processed legally, ethically, and without bias. They must also be aware of potential conflicts of interest and maintain objectivity throughout their investigations.

6. Collaboration

Forensic scientists often work as part of a team, collaborating with other experts, such as crime scene investigators, medical examiners, or forensic psychologists. Effective collaboration requires strong interpersonal skills, the ability to listen to others' perspectives, and open communication.

7. Problem-Solving Skills

Forensic investigations often involve complex and challenging problems that require creative thinking and problem-solving skills. Forensic scientists must be able to identify the key issues, devise strategies to address them, and evaluate the effectiveness of their solutions.

8. Time Management

Forensic investigations often have strict deadlines, and forensic scientists must be able to manage their time effectively to meet these deadlines. They must prioritize tasks, delegate responsibilities when necessary, and ensure that their work is completed on time.

9. Adaptability

Forensic scientists must be adaptable and flexible, as each case can present unique challenges and require different approaches. They must be willing to learn new techniques, adapt to changing circumstances, and adjust their methods as needed.

10. Attention to Safety

Many forensic investigations involve handling hazardous materials, such as blood, drugs, or chemicals. Forensic scientists must follow strict safety protocols and procedures to protect themselves and others from potential harm. Attention to safety is critical in preventing accidents and ensuring that evidence is not contaminated.
